
Wills Lifestyle India Fashion Week Autumn Winter 2010
Celebrating its 15th edition on the runway
Asia’s biggest business of fashion event, Wills Lifestyle India Fashion Week 2010 (WIFW), introduces an assortment of striking collections from 130 designers on the runway and the exhibition areas. With 43 shows and 130 stalls, the premier event offers five enthralling days of inspiration, ingenuity and imagination aligned with business opportunities. WIFW has a new technological aspect of connecting with the masses. It’s for first time in the history of Indian fashion industry that the fashion conscious public will be able to access and watch this grand event live on cyberspace.
Being 15 seasons old, WIFW attracts designers from all over the country and overseas through an exchange programme.
